Position Summary

The Director of Nursing (DON) is responsible for the overall leadership, direction, and coordination of nursing services to ensure the delivery of safe, high-quality, and cost-effective patient care. The DON works collaboratively with center leadership, physicians, and clinical staff to support operational excellence, regulatory compliance, and superior patient outcomes.

 

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Leadership & Communication

  • Collaborates with center leadership to provide oversight and direction of nursing care and patient scheduling in accordance with center policies, procedures, and objectives
  • Effectively presents information and responds to questions while maintaining professional relationships with physicians, leaders, staff, vendors, patients, and the general public
  • Serves as a clinical leader and resource to nursing and support teams

Patient Care & Clinical Oversight

  • Analyzes and evaluates nursing care practices to improve quality outcomes
  • Coordinates patient care activities with surgeons and anesthesia providers to ensure continuity of care
  • Participates in patient care as needed and oversees clinical areas to ensure patient needs are met
  • Enforces nursing practice standards, licensure requirements, and accreditation regulations
  • Acts as a liaison between patients, families, and the healthcare team
  • Reviews, revises, and implements patient care policies and procedures as needed
  • Responds to emergency situations and ensures staff competency during emergencies
  • Oversees nursing activities during emergencies to ensure patient safety
  • Manages patient and staff flow to reduce the risk of healthcare-associated and surgical site infections
  • Reviews and analyzes clinical documentation for compliance with policies, procedures, and regulations

Staffing & Personnel Management

  • Monitors FTE utilization and recommends cost-effective staffing and scheduling practices
  • Oversees orientation programs for new clinical employees
  • Recommends and assists with continuing education and professional development for staff
  • Prepares and adjusts clinical staffing schedules based on daily operational needs, staff skill level, holidays, and vacations
  • Ensures appropriate cross-training across clinical areas
  • Reviews time and attendance records as required
  • Observes, evaluates, and supports performance improvement of all clinical personnel
  • Interprets and enforces center policies and procedures
  • Works with leadership to address staff concerns, suggestions, and performance improvement opportunities

Safety & Regulatory Compliance

  • Promotes adherence to safety policies and best practices
  • Partners with center leadership and the Safety Officer to implement regulatory standards and workplace safety initiatives
  • Maintains a safe, clean, and efficient clinical environment
  • Oversees care, cleaning, disinfection, sterilization, and maintenance of clinical instruments and equipment
  • Identifies and reports deficiencies in supplies, equipment, and contracted services
  • Submits required documentation to risk management, as applicable
  • Ensures OSHA compliance and availability of required safety supplies

Financial & Materials Management

  • Promotes efficient use of center resources and cost containment
  • Evaluates clinical needs and makes purchasing recommendations within budget guidelines
  • Assists in the development and implementation of operating and capital budgets, as required

General Responsibilities

  • Actively participates in center committees, meetings, in-services, and staff development activities
  • Contributes input toward short- and long-term operational and clinical goals
  • Performs additional duties as assigned

 

Qualifications

  • Active RN license in the state of New Jersey
  • Minimum of 3-5 years of nursing leadership experience (ASC, endoscopy, perioperative, or acute care preferred)
  • Strong knowledge of regulatory, accreditation, and professional nursing standards
  • Proven leadership, communication, and organizational skills
  •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ced outpatient surgical environment
